Abstract
In recent years, Cloud computing is considered the next-generation computing paradigm. Cloud services could be broadly classified as software as a service (SaaS), platform as a service (PaaS) and infrastructure as a service (IaaS). However, most cloud providers only pay attention to certain services. This makes users vex about which cloud provider to be chosen, and when they need different services. Therefore, integrating these computing resources to satisfy users´ various requirements is an important issue. In this study, we present a Peer-to-Peer (P2P) resource search mechanism which adopts P2P networking technologies to orchestrate all the computing resources. Through this P2P resource search mechanism, cloud users can discover the computing resources in different cloud provides.
